Positive Thinking - Values and Assumptions


At times, I easily lose prospect of thinking positive when the negativity around me creates a barrier. But after that I utilize my power of positive thinking. I want to get rid of thinking negative and then thinking positive, means I want to think positive only. Let’s chat about how does positive thinking works with what we value and what we assume.


Values.. They define who we are and help us to figure out what we want and how we live our life. Everyone have different values, and positive thinking fits everybody according to those values. I value being nice to my parents and helping them. This makes me feel good. I have this value and it assists me in maintaining a high level of positive attitude. I can never think of troubling them but instead I focus in knowing that what I can do to make them feel good. Sometimes negative feelings also rule my mind. Like, when I and my mom have different opinions on some topics and I don’t do what mom says. But by reviewing my values, I maintain positive thinking at a time and give in to my mom’s views or I try instead to bring her around to agreeing what I think is right.

 
Assumptions..We often make assumptions to fill in an unknown. And more often we assume the worst. We give negative assumptions on everything which makes us fearful and worrisome. Last year my brother met with a major accident while he was driving back home late night. After that incident, I am always worried and don’t sleep until he comes back home. That horrible day always forces me to think negative and it tend to dig me deeper in a pool of negativity. Then I have to ask myself whether I know the answer or I am just making assumptions. I actively refuse those negative assumptions and try to focus internally on the positives.

What I want to say is if one cannot make positive assumptions, they should at least sway his mind from the negative ones.
